Edwards, Gardiner family fonds
CA ACU GBA F0712 · Fundos · 1795-2000, predominant 1863-1964

The fonds is very rich in correspondence which details life in southern Alberta, ranching, childhood, and the relationships between family members. It consists of: Oliver's correspondence and Treaty 8 trip diary (1900); Henrietta's diaries (1864, 1867), a few speeches and writings, correspondence, and Persons Case memorabilia; Alice's correspondence, diary (1940), and wedding records; Muir's diary (1897); Margaret's correspondence (very little); Amelia's correspondence and letters to the editor; Claude's ranching diaries (1905-1927) and correspondence (1894-1919); Laura's and Barbara's correspondence; Claudia's school records, diaries (1920-1928), and correspondence; Gard's school records, diaries (1920, 1926), and Persons Case memorabilia; extensive family photographs; genealogical charts; and miscellaneous documents of various ancestors.

A.E. Cross family fonds
CA ACU GBA F0609 · Fundos · 1836-1987, predominant 1890-1987

The fonds consists of extensive correspondence between A.E. Cross and Helen Cross (1899-1928); correspondence of A.E. Cross pertaining to the brewery, ranch, personal matters, and organizations in which he was active (1890-1932); correspondence of J.B. Cross regarding the brewery, ranch and personal matters (1933-1937); A7 Ranche business correspondence (1913-1943); Calgary Brewing and Malting Company business correspondence (1892-1906); Helen's correspondence and records of organization in which she was active (1880-1944); correspondence and school records of the Cross children (1912-1948); family memorabilia (1892-1949); correspondence and business records of Sandy Cross and Rothney Farm (1935-1987); and extensive photographs of the Cross family, the A7 Ranche, and Rothney Farm.

Peace River Country Research Project collection
CA ACU GBA C0078 · Coleção · Compiled 1955-1956 (originally created 1837-1956)

The collection consists of typescripts of interviews (1955-1956), reminiscences, diaries (1897-1914), and autobiographies; files of biographical and historical notes; and photographs of pioneers and the area. Includes typescripts of Fort St. John fur trade post journal (1866-1924), and Fort Dunvegan post account book (1837-1864).

Alexander Begg fonds
CA ACU GBA F0176 · Fundos · 1843-1914
  • The fonds consists of correspondence (1854-1905) relating to his newspaper businesses, the Temperance Colonization Society, the crofters' immigration scheme, the Alaskan boundary, and the Dunbow Ranche; legal records; diaries (1842-1904); correspondence, minutes and incorporation documents for the railway company; and certificates, appointments and commissions. Includes Emily's correspondence (1853-1914) and photographs of the Begg family.

Glenbow Archives Posters collection
CA ACU GBA C0176 · Coleção · [ca. 1845-1968]

The collection consists of posters related to a wide variety of topics including the promotion of immigration to Canada; the sale of Victory bonds and recruitment for the wars; advertisements for rail and steamship travel; and announcements of auction sales, sports meets, and social events.
